Wrestling Legends: A Tale of Creative Leadership

The world of professional wrestling is a fascinating blend of athleticism, storytelling, and behind-the-scenes politics. And when it comes to the latter, the recent transition of power within WWE is a compelling narrative in itself.

Jeff Jarrett, a veteran of the wrestling industry and a WWE Hall of Famer, has offered a unique perspective on the challenges faced by his fellow Hall of Famer, Paul 'Triple H' Levesque, who now wields the creative power in WWE. This is a story of leadership, accountability, and the pressures of being at the top.

The Creative Chair: A Seat of Power and Responsibility

Being the head of creative in any entertainment business is no easy feat. It's a role that demands vision, storytelling prowess, and the ability to manage diverse talents. But in the world of wrestling, it's even more complex. As Jarrett points out, it's about 'servant leadership', a term that encapsulates the unique dynamic between those in charge and the performers they lead.

Triple H, having stepped into this role after the retirement of Vince McMahon, finds himself in a position where he must answer to many, from top talents to executives above him. It's a delicate balance, as he must appease those under his leadership while also making decisions that may not always be his own. This is the reality of being at the top—a position that comes with immense power but also immense responsibility.
